Berry Petroleum Company LLC is proposing to rework a single existing steamflood injector well, API #0403066975, known as Hill 631X, located in Section 19, Township 28 South, Range 21 East, Bakersfield and Merced Meridian, within the South Belridge Oil Field in Kern County, California. The scope of work involves minor downhole modifications such as perforating, repairing or replacing casing components, installing or removing cement plugs and packers, and other maintenance activities essential to sustain existing operations without expanding surface infrastructure or altering the previously approved use of the well. The project is subject to regulatory review under the California Environmental Quality Act, with CalGEM determining that it qualifies for categorical exemptions under 14 CCR §§ 15301, 15302, and 15304, as it involves the maintenance and minor alteration of existing facilities without significant environmental impact. The California Department of Conservation, Geologic Energy Management Division, serves as the permitting authority and the sole contracting entity; no federal acquisition regulations or clauses apply as this is a state-regulated environmental permitting action, not a federal procurement. The place of performance is the well site itself, with inspection and acceptance tied to regulatory approval by CalGEM rather than a formal contract inspection process.
